This position is posted by Jobgether on behalf of a partner company. We are currently looking for a Key Account Manager, Vision Care-Northeast Region in United States.
This role is a high-impact commercial position focused on driving growth, profitability, and market share across a portfolio of strategic vision care accounts in the Northeast region.
You will be responsible for building and maintaining strong, long-term relationships with key customers while deeply understanding their business needs and patient care challenges.
The position requires a strategic mindset to develop account plans, identify growth opportunities, and deliver tailored solutions that enhance commercial performance.
You will collaborate closely with internal cross-functional teams, including marketing and medical, to execute integrated account strategies.
A strong emphasis is placed on negotiation, contract management, and delivering measurable sales outcomes across complex healthcare accounts.
This role also involves significant field engagement, including customer visits, events, and approximately 50% travel within the assigned territory.
- Manage and grow a portfolio of strategic key accounts by developing trusted relationships with key stakeholders and decision-makers.
- Identify customer needs and translate them into tailored solutions that improve patient care and drive business performance.
- Develop and execute comprehensive account strategies and tactical plans aligned with broader commercial objectives.
- Negotiate contracts and lead account-specific initiatives to maximize revenue, profitability, and market share.
- Monitor market trends and competitive activity to inform strategic decisions and strengthen account positioning.
- Coordinate and support customer events and programs in collaboration with marketing and medical teams.
- Maintain accurate CRM data, stakeholder mapping, and account segmentation to support informed decision-making.
- Achieve sales targets and contribute to overall regional sales and performance goals.
- Bachelor’s degree or equivalent relevant experience (or equivalent combinations such as high school + 13 years, associate + 9 years, or master’s + 2 years).
- Minimum of 5 years of experience in key account management, sales, or a related commercial role, preferably within healthcare, medical devices, or vision care.
- Strong ability to build and maintain executive-level relationships with complex accounts.
- Proven track record of driving revenue growth, managing large accounts, and achieving sales targets.
- Excellent negotiation, communication, and stakeholder management skills.
- Strong analytical mindset with the ability to assess market dynamics and develop strategic account plans.
- Comfortable working in a fast-paced, field-based role with approximately 50% travel.
- Fluency in English, with strong written and verbal communication skills.
